Handover note — from Odile to Bren, Sarkwell Depot. The support team's night-shift rotation starts Monday; visiting contractors from Mirefield Systems will shadow them through Wednesday. Please walk contractors through the east corridor route, confirm they sign the after-hours register, and remind them the lift is badge-restricted past 20:00. For their supervised entries this week, they should use the temporary code below.

door code, bajef-taduf: bdg-XBH-3

Subject: Cut-over recap — health checks behind the new LB

Hi Deshawn,

Quick summary before you review the PR. We moved Pondside's API pods behind the new Greylake balancer last night. The old TCP-only health checks were marking half-dead pods healthy, so we switched to HTTP checks hitting the readiness endpoint with a tighter failure threshold. Two pods flapped during the switch, recovered on their own, no customer impact we can see. For the review, the live check settings are below.

settings of bafof-fajog:
[aldix]
port = 9300
region = north-3
host = aldix.kelvilabs.example
team = istath
timeout_ms = 1500
retries = 8

Summary for sales leads: the divestiture of the Harrowgate Instruments unit to Pellin Group closed last month. Proceeds retire the revolving facility and fund expansion of the Veltrix product family. Customers of the sold unit transition over two quarters; commission structures for affected accounts wind down on the same schedule. No headcount changes in the remaining sales organisation. Pipeline targets for next year are being rebased accordingly. One strategic point requires your attention.

board note of bawep-tajef: Queniusek Systems plans to raise the Quenvan list price by 53.1 percent in March. The pricing group signed off on a budget of $176.4 million for Project Drueth. The renewal with Casionix Partners closes at $142.5 million a year, 8.3 percent below the last contract. Project Fraax slips by six weeks because of the tooling delay.